About The Provider
Benjamin Berthold, DNP, is a child and adolescent psychologist at Intermountain Health’s Primary Children’s Behavioral Health in Taylorsville, Utah. He supports patients and their families in Taylorsville, South Jordan, West Valley, and surrounding communities treating ADHD, anxiety, mood disorders, OCD, disorder eating, trauma, autism-related challenges, and more. Benjamin is most energized by cases where he can truly partner with patients and families, reduce suffering, and connect the dots between lived experience and biology.
As a caregiver, Benjamin believes in being compassionate and practical, while using evidence-based practices. He spent his entire career in the caring professions—from five years as a bedside ICU nurse to his current work as a psychiatric mental health nurse practitioner (PMHNP). He’s witnessed people recover from profound adversity, and that perspective grounds his practice in humility, persistence, and patient-centered goals.
Outside the clinic, the Boise, ID native is a runner and triathlon enthusiast who loves long trail days, and the reset that movement brings.
